Tourism | Hotel Sun Sun revamps restaurant with a taste of Macanese and Portuguese food

IMG_0134Hotel Sun Sun’s restaurant has been revamped and is now focusing on Portuguese and Macanese gastronomy. Located in the Inner Harbor area, Hotel Sun Sun is also due to be renovated by famed Portuguese architect Siza Vieira.
“The Square Restaurant” offers a Macanese and Portuguese-inspired menu, also providing traditional dishes sprinkled with a Chinese flavor.
The restaurant’s menu is designed and prepared by Chinese chef Ji Hui Li, who has worked in different Portuguese restaurants before.
A food tasting event that was held last week showcased some of the most popular dishes on the menu. The famed Caldo Verde soup with a bit of a spicy flavor; jumbo shrimps in garlic sauce, grilled cuttlefish with baked potatoes, roast beef, and duck rice are just some of the options on the menu.
The restaurant reopened with the new menu in July. The chef is focusing on family-portion dishes, mixing Portuguese and Macanese flavors.
Hotel Sun Sun, located in Praça Ponte e Horta, is also due to be revamped by Portuguese architect Álvaro Siza Vieira. The hotel is owned by the family of Yany Kwan, who owns a recently opened gallery in the city center, Macpro Gallery.
They are hoping to revamp the whole area while renovating the hotel, working toward sustainable growth and providing an environment ideal for small and medium-sized enterprises to establish in the Inner Harbor area.
Siza Vieira said in a recent press conference that the hotel will undergo major changes in its interior design, in order to create “a new character.” Alongside architect Carlos Castanheira, Siza intends to introduce a new interior design strategy, focusing on the room display, furniture and lighting.
Despite wanting to introduce a few changes to the façade and the exteriors, the architects plan to maintain the existing structure. CP
